Identifying Your Needs

The first step in choosing the right cable insulation material is to understand your specific needs. Consider the following factors:

  • Environmental Conditions: Will the cables be exposed to extreme temperatures, moisture, or chemicals?
  • Electrical Requirements: What is the voltage rating and current-carrying capacity needed?
  • Mechanical Aspects: Will the cables be subject to abrasion, impact, or bending?
  • Regulatory Standards: Are there specific certifications or standards your cables must meet?

Understanding these factors will guide you in selecting the right insulation material, making the purchasing process efficient and straightforward.

Electrical Insulation Properties

One of the primary concerns customers have relates to the electrical insulation properties of the material. Different insulation materials have varying dielectric strengths. For instance, XLPE (cross-linked polyethylene) offers a dielectric strength of around 20 kV/mm, making it suitable for high-voltage applications. On the other hand, PVC (polyvinyl chloride) is more common for lower voltage applications.

Thermal Stability

Thermal stability is another critical factor. Materials like silicone rubber can withstand temperatures ranging from -60°C to +200°C, making them ideal for harsh environments. In contrast, PVC can typically handle temperatures up to 70°C. This difference can impact the longevity and reliability of your cables.

Moisture Resistance

If moisture is a concern, selecting a material that is resistant to water is essential. Polyurethane (PUR) insulation is highly effective in moist conditions, reducing the risk of short circuits.
